You said that you like to put data where it will be easy to select.
Other than for the simplest of selections, MVs make this more complex.
For example, let's say you need to select on certain area codes for
(say) one type of phone. Sure, this is all do-able when you have the
associated MV set (with print limiting and BY-EXP) like you do, but
it's rediculously simple when the area code is in it's own attribute.
You also said that you like to allow for future growth and expansion.
Yes, it's always visually appealing to keep thinks together. But let's
face it, database requirements change and somewhere down the road the
DBA has to add a new field to the record and shuffling fields to keep
things physically together is just not an option due to the immense
application changes that would be required. Ok, you say you have an
associated 'phone type' attribute. What if (someday) you need to add a
'phone extention' and there are no available adjacent attributes? Uh
oh! ;-)
I have to admit, looking at the database design from the output side
of things might cause one to decide on one structure over another.
However, I've always gone by the 'Do the simplest thing that could
possibly work' principle.

I can answer that one, Charlie.
I worked several years managing mailing lists and it was always
best to segregate different phone numbers (home, business,
mobile, fax, etc) into different attributes. In fact, we even
split each number into 3 attributes, area code, exchange and last
4-digits (we didn't deal with international) for ease of doing
ENGLISH/ACCESS/RECALL (take your 'pick' ;-) ) selections. I think
you can see where this is going but if they were all stored as
multi-values then which MV would be which phone? Positional data
structures will always lead to more complex coding and
maintenance. And the very last thing you want to do is add
unnecessary complexity to an already complex application.
When I design a database I always do it with
English/Access/Recall/JQL in mind. I will use the term English to
refer to the ad-hoc retrieval system, and Pick to refer to all the
Multivalue implementations. I know that's inconsistent, English
belongs to Reality, Access belongs to Pick, but what the heck,
most old-timers like myself recognize both readily. I much prefer
to generate reports using English if at all possible. To that end,
I like to put data where it will be easy to select and report on.
I also like to allow for future growth and expansion. If you allow
an attribute for home and work phone, what do you do when you get
new phone types, like emergency contact, fax, pager, work cell and
personal cell? There may come new phone number types down the road
that we've never even heard of. You'll need to allocate additional
attributes which may not be close to the original phone numbers.
Even if you leave attributes empty for expansion, you may not have
enough. When I multivalue phone numbers, I also add an attribute
for phone type. This way I can associate the 2 attributes, and use
only 2 columns on a report. Even with the advent of emailing
reports and browsers, many are still printed on real printers,
usually limited to 132 characters. Using separate attributes and
printing them all in one column will call for some dictionary
trickery. It can be done, but now you have the complexity you
wanted to avoid in the first place. If you only want to print work
phone, for instance, you have no problem. Well, neither do I.
English will handle this quite nicely. I-descriptors add even more
flexibility.
Which would you prefer, a simple attribute reference or a complex
F or A correlative (or I-type) just to extract, and format, the
proper value. And what if someone wanted it formated with 'dots'
instead of 'dashes'. It really makes managing it much simpler to
break things up into their smallest (atomic) elements; very
similar the the OOP approach to coding by having methods do the
smallest piece of work so that programs can be constructed, like
an erector set (or tinker toys).
Formatting phone numbers is a piece of cake (or pie, if that's
your preference). I like to control data entry such that the user
can enter the phone number in any of several accepted formats, and
store only the digits. In this way I can format the phone number
for display or printing as ###-###-####, ###.###.####, ### ###
#### or (###) ###-####, set by the application standards and
conventions. Non-US numbers can be detected and formatted properly
as well, using a country code as part of the address. Two
attributes to keep track of, no matter how many phone types, as
opposed to 2 + (or 6 +) whatever. Print limiting and exploding
sorts are tools which provide an almost unlimited level of
flexibility. I would hope that every programmer would gain some
knowledge about both.
We did similar things with names by breaking them up into 6
attributes: saluation (Mr, Ms, etc), first name, middle initial,
lastname, suffix (jr, sr, etc), title (eg President). This
structure gave us the power to mix and match things any way we
wanted without a lot of effort.
I completely agree here. It is much easier to control the data as
it is entered, rather than trying to figure out what the user
decided to put where - the whole name in the first or last name,
etc. I do the same with addresses (except address 1 and 2, which
are multivalued). City, state, zip and country code are all
separate pieces of data.
